Preparations are now underway for Cotton Club North, the 21st Annual ‘40s Dance scheduled for Sunday, April 18, 2010. Cotton Club North is an evening of incredible musical performances by our very own talented NNHS jazz musicians and vocalists. The event also features raffles and auction items. This year’s dance is being held at Bobak’s Signature Room (in Woodridge–10 minutes from North) from 5p-9p.  Click on each of these links for more information about the EVENT, about SWING DANCE LESSONS, about the RAFFLE/AUCTION, and about AD SALES for the PROGRAM.

VFW Plans to Honor Educators
Judd Kendall VFW Post 3873 is proud to announce the second Kendall Honors awards program. This program was instituted to honor the unsung heroes of the Naperville community. The Post will honor the policeman of the year, the firefighter of the year, and the educators of the year at the elementary, middle/junior high and high school levels in Districts 203 and 204.  Any Naperville resident or resident of Districts 203 and 204 can nominate their candidate for policeman of the year, fireman of the year or educator of the year. The application forms are on the VFW 3873 website, www.napervfw3873.org. They are on the menu on the left. The nomination forms say, Nominate Police, Nominate Fireman, Nominate Teacher. The forms are interactive and will come directly to the committee when you click submit. Or you can mail the form to the Post at 908 West Jackson, Naperville, IL 60540.
 
NNHS Fashion Show Fundraiser Feb 21

NNHS Fashion Show Fundraiser -- Feb 21   The Naperville North Booster Club will host its 10th annual Seniors on Parade fashion show fundraiser on Sunday, February 21, 2010 starting at 11 AM at Bobak's Signature Room in Woodridge.  This year's event theme is Groovy Seniors: a retrospective on the 1960s.  Over 100 seniors will represent the Class of 2010 as they walk the runway modeling fashions from a variety of local independent retailers as well as national chains. Doors open at 11 AM for raffle prize viewing and a performance by the NNHS Jazz Band. Lunch begins at 12:15 PM, followed by the fashion show at 1:30 PM.  Early bird tickets are available through February 1 for $35/person and $20 for both NNHS students & children under 12. 

Click Here: for an order form.  Ticket prices will go up to $40/person and $25 for NNHS students and children after February 1.  All proceeds go directly to the NNHS Booster Club so they can continue to financially support all North extra-curricular teams, clubs and activities.
